vue-quill-editor icon indicating copy to clipboard operation
vue-quill-editor copied to clipboard

如何插入<a>标签?

Open weiyierlei opened this issue 6 years ago • 4 comments

vm.$refs.myQuillEditor.quill.insertEmbed(vm.addRange !== null ? vm.addRange.index : 0, 'image', value, Quill.sources.USER)

我在用这个编辑器自定义toolbar按钮操作时用到上传功能,最后得到一个url值,我需要在编辑器里显示出来,如果是图片我给第二个参数'image'就可以了,那如果我想显示一个a标签呢,查了文档用参数‘link’也没用(不报错但插入了空白),求告知

weiyierlei avatar Apr 02 '18 07:04 weiyierlei

这得测试,我建议去 quill issues 里找一下答案,我暂时没时间

surmon-china avatar Apr 18 '18 05:04 surmon-china

vm.$refs.myQuillEditor.quill.insertEmbed(vm.addRange !== null ? vm.addRange.index : 0, 'image', value, Quill.sources.USER)

我在用这个编辑器自定义toolbar按钮操作时用到上传功能,最后得到一个url值,我需要在编辑器里显示出来,如果是图片我给第二个参数'image'就可以了,那如果我想显示一个a标签呢,查了文档用参数‘link’也没用(不报错但插入了空白),求告知

这个问题解决了吗,亲

EleShader avatar Feb 20 '19 02:02 EleShader

@weiyierlei 老哥,这个问题解决了么?我也想这样弄一下看文档没有说怎么处理

chenfaxiang avatar May 10 '19 09:05 chenfaxiang

我也遇见了一模一样的问题,image 可以,link 不可以,求帮助

editor.insertEmbed(1, 'image', 'https://www.baidu.com/img/flexible/logo/pc/result.png', 'api'); // it works
editor.insertEmbed(2, 'link', { href: 'https://www.baidu.com', innerText: '百度首页' }, 'api');  // not work

wuliupo avatar Dec 05 '20 10:12 wuliupo